Advances in Inertial Navigation Algorithms for Precise Positioning

💡 AI-Assisted Content: Parts of this article were generated with the help of AI. Please verify important details using reliable or official sources.

Inertial navigation algorithms are critical components of modern navigation systems, enabling precise position and velocity estimation without reliance on external signals. Their reliability underpins applications ranging from aviation to autonomous transportation.

Understanding their mathematical foundations and addressing inherent error challenges are essential for advancing this technology within inertial navigation systems.

Fundamentals of Inertial Navigation Algorithms

Inertial navigation algorithms are centered on estimating the position, velocity, and orientation of a moving object using data from inertial sensors. These algorithms process measurements from accelerometers and gyroscopes to continuously update the navigation solution without relying on external references.

The core principle involves integrating sensor signals over time to determine changes in a system’s state. This process requires accurate mathematical models to convert raw sensor data into meaningful positional information. The algorithms must account for the dynamics and kinematics specific to the application, ensuring precision and stability.

Implementing inertial navigation algorithms demands a solid understanding of their mathematical foundations, including techniques such as dead reckoning and Kalman filtering. These methods help to filter noise, reduce errors, and improve estimation accuracy. Proper algorithm design is essential for reliable performance, especially in environments where external signals are unavailable or unreliable.

Mathematical Foundations for Inertial Navigation

Mathematical foundations for inertial navigation rely on the principles of calculus, linear algebra, and kinematics to model motion. The core concept involves using vector mathematics to represent positional, velocity, and acceleration data obtained from inertial sensors.

Differential equations describe the relationship between these quantities over time, enabling the integration of acceleration signals to estimate velocity and position. This process requires understanding coordinate transformations, such as converting measurements from body-fixed to navigation frames using rotation matrices or quaternions.

Sensor biases and noise are incorporated into these models mathematically, often through stochastic processes like the Kalman filter. This allows the algorithms to estimate and correct errors dynamically based on sensor data and system models. Ultimately, a solid grasp of these mathematical principles underpins the precise and reliable operation of inertial navigation algorithms.

Types of Inertial Navigation Algorithms

Inertial Navigation Algorithms can be broadly categorized based on their operational principles and computational approaches. The primary types include dead reckoning algorithms, strap-down algorithms, and strap-in algorithms. Dead reckoning relies solely on inertial sensor data to estimate position and velocity over time without external references, making it suitable for short-term navigation.

Strap-down algorithms interpret data from Inertial Measurement Units (IMUs) using computational models to calculate orientation, position, and velocity. These algorithms are more common due to their simplicity and compatibility with modern sensors. Conversely, strap-in algorithms integrate external data, such as GPS signals, to correct drift errors inherent in inertial sensors.

Furthermore, modern inertial navigation algorithms employ Kalman filtering techniques, such as the Extended Kalman Filter (EKF) or Unscented Kalman Filter (UKF), to fuse inertial data with external inputs efficiently. These hybrid approaches improve accuracy and robustness in dynamic environments, making them integral in advanced inertial navigation systems.

See also  Understanding Kalman Filtering in Navigation Systems for Enhanced Accuracy

Error Sources and Mitigation in Navigation Algorithms

Sensor drift and biases are primary sources of error in inertial navigation algorithms, causing cumulative inaccuracies over time. These inaccuracies can degrade system performance if not properly corrected. Techniques such as calibration and periodic sensor updates help mitigate these issues by ensuring sensor readings remain accurate.

Error correction techniques are vital in maintaining navigation accuracy. Kalman filtering, for instance, integrates signals from various sensors to reduce noise and compensate for drift. Additionally, zero-velocity updates or external aids like GPS enhance the robustness of inertial navigation algorithms by correcting accumulated errors.

Understanding the specific error sources allows for targeted mitigation strategies, ensuring greater reliability of inertial navigation systems. Combining advanced correction techniques and sensor calibration significantly enhances the precision and longevity of inertial navigation algorithms in practical applications.

Sensor drift and biases

Sensor drift and biases refer to systematic errors that accumulate over time within inertial sensors, such as gyroscopes and accelerometers. These errors cause deviations in sensor outputs, leading to inaccuracies in navigation calculations. Over prolonged operation, even minor biases can significantly affect system performance.

Biases are typically constant or slowly varying offsets introduced during manufacturing, calibration, or due to environmental influences. Sensor drift refers to the gradual change in sensor readings caused by temperature fluctuations, aging components, or mechanical stress. These effects can distort inertial measurements if not properly accounted for.

Mitigating sensor drift and biases is critical for ensuring the accuracy of inertial navigation algorithms. Techniques such as calibration procedures, bias estimation algorithms, and adaptive filtering are employed to compensate for these errors. Effective correction methods help maintain reliable positioning over extended periods, especially when combined with sensor fusion strategies.

Error correction techniques

Error correction techniques in inertial navigation algorithms are vital for maintaining accuracy over time. They primarily involve identifying and compensating for sensor errors, such as biases and drift, which accumulate and degrade navigation performance.

One common approach is the implementation of calibration procedures that adjust sensor outputs based on known references or controlled conditions. These can be performed periodically to realign sensor measurements, reducing cumulative errors.

Another effective method is the use of algorithms like zero-velocity updates (ZUPT), which leverage known stationary periods to reset accumulated errors. This technique is especially valuable in pedestrian navigation systems, where brief stationarity is frequent.

Additionally, statistical methods like Kalman filtering or complementary filtering play a significant role. They fuse inertial sensor data with external measurements, such as GPS or vision-based inputs, to correct errors dynamically. These techniques enhance the robustness of inertial navigation algorithms against sensor inaccuracies.

Sensor Fusion and Hybrid Approaches

Sensor fusion and hybrid approaches integrate data from multiple inertial navigation sensors and external sources to enhance accuracy and reliability. This method addresses limitations inherent in individual sensors, such as drift or noise, by combining complementary information.

Common techniques include Kalman filtering, complementary filtering, and particle filtering, which weigh and process sensor data to produce more precise position and orientation estimates. These algorithms enable robust navigation even under challenging conditions where sensor performance may vary.

Hybrid approaches often combine inertial navigation algorithms with other systems like GPS, vision, or magnetometers. This multi-sensor integration compensates for each system’s weaknesses, ensuring continuous, accurate navigation across diverse environments. These approaches are increasingly vital in complex applications like autonomous vehicles and aerospace systems.

See also  Advancements in Gyroscopes for Inertial Navigation Systems

Real-Time Processing Challenges

Real-time processing challenges in inertial navigation algorithms primarily stem from the need for rapid computation without sacrificing accuracy and stability. These algorithms must process data continuously, often in embedded systems with limited processing power, making efficiency crucial.

Maintaining computational speed while handling complex mathematical models demands optimized algorithms and hardware. Any delays can lead to outdated position estimates, reducing system reliability, especially in dynamic environments such as UAVs or autonomous vehicles.

Additionally, algorithm stability and robustness are vital, as real-time systems face unpredictable disturbances and sensor noise. Ensuring consistent performance requires designing algorithms resilient to error accumulation. Balancing processing speed and accuracy remains a key challenge in deploying inertial navigation algorithms effectively.

Computational efficiency considerations

Efficiency in computational processes is vital for inertial navigation algorithms, especially when deployed in real-time systems. Optimizing algorithmic complexity ensures faster data processing, reducing latency and enhancing system responsiveness. Techniques such as reducing mathematical operations and using simplified models can significantly improve performance without sacrificing accuracy.

Additionally, selecting appropriate data structures and leveraging hardware acceleration, like specialized processors or parallel computing, can further enhance efficiency. These strategies enable inertial navigation systems to operate reliably within the constraints of limited computational resources.

Maintaining an optimal balance between computational load and navigation accuracy is critical. Developers often implement approximation methods or filter techniques that lessen processing demands while preserving essential data integrity. This approach ensures the algorithms remain robust and stable during extended operation periods, even under constrained computing environments.

Algorithm stability and robustness

Algorithm stability and robustness are vital for maintaining the accuracy and reliability of inertial navigation systems over time. Stable algorithms prevent error accumulation, ensuring consistent performance despite measurement noise or environmental disturbances.

Robustness refers to an algorithm’s capacity to withstand uncertainties like sensor biases, drift, or external shocks. Effective inertial navigation algorithms incorporate fault-tolerant mechanisms and adaptive filtering techniques, such as Kalman filters, to mitigate these issues and improve resilience.

To achieve both stability and robustness, algorithms often utilize error detection and correction strategies, including sensor fusion methods. These techniques enable the system to compensate for faults or anomalies, thereby preserving navigation accuracy under varied operational conditions.

Overall, ensuring stability and robustness in inertial navigation algorithms is crucial for consistent and dependable system performance, especially in demanding environments like aerospace, maritime, or autonomous vehicles.

Implementation of Inertial Navigation Algorithms

Effective implementation of inertial navigation algorithms requires careful consideration of both hardware and software components. Precision sensors such as accelerometers and gyroscopes must be calibrated to minimize measurement errors that can accumulate over time. Proper calibration ensures consistent data quality, which is vital for reliable navigation.

Hardware selection impacts algorithm performance significantly. High-quality inertial measurement units (IMUs) with low bias drift and noise characteristics enhance algorithm stability. Integration of additional sensors, like magnetometers or GPS, forms the basis for sensor fusion, further improving accuracy during implementation.

On the software side, optimization strategies are essential to ensure real-time processing. Efficient coding practices, including algorithm simplification and parallel processing, help meet computational efficiency requirements. Additionally, implementing robust filtering techniques, such as Kalman filters, mitigates the effects of sensor bias and drift.

Overall, implementation involves balancing hardware calibration, sensor selection, and software optimization. These factors collectively determine the effectiveness of inertial navigation algorithms in practical systems, ensuring precise and reliable navigation even under challenging operational conditions.

See also  Advances in the Integration of GPS and INS for Enhanced Navigation Accuracy

Hardware considerations and calibration

Hardware considerations are fundamental to the effective implementation of inertial navigation algorithms. The selection of high-quality sensors, such as accelerometers and gyroscopes, directly influences system accuracy and reliability. Precise sensor specifications and manufacturing standards help minimize initial errors and noise.

Calibration plays a vital role in ensuring sensor data integrity. Regular calibration routines account for sensor biases, drifts, and scale factor deviations. Techniques like static and dynamic calibration can effectively reduce cumulative errors, thereby enhancing the overall performance of inertial navigation systems.

Proper hardware integration also involves mechanical stability and environmental resilience. Vibration damping and temperature compensation are essential to maintain sensor precision under varying operational conditions. Additionally, isolating sensitive components from electromagnetic interference prevents signal distortion that could compromise navigation accuracy.

In summary, thoughtful hardware considerations and meticulous calibration are crucial in optimizing inertial navigation algorithms. They ensure high-fidelity sensor data, which forms the foundation for accurate and robust inertial navigation system performance.

Software optimization strategies

Effective software optimization strategies for inertial navigation algorithms focus on enhancing computational efficiency and ensuring real-time responsiveness. Implementing streamlined data structures and efficient coding practices reduces processing delays, which are critical for accurate navigation.

Utilization of fixed-point arithmetic, instead of floating-point calculations, can also lower computational load, especially on embedded systems with limited hardware resources. This approach maintains accuracy while optimizing speed and power consumption.

Additionally, optimizing algorithm code involves minimizing unnecessary calculations, employing recursive algorithms, and using parallel processing techniques such as multi-threading. These practices help improve stability and robustness in real-time operations.

Careful calibration and tuning of software parameters further contribute to reducing processing errors. Overall, employing these software optimization strategies ensures inertial navigation algorithms operate efficiently, reliably, and with higher accuracy in diverse system environments.

Applications of Inertial Navigation Algorithms in Systems

Inertial navigation algorithms are integral to various advanced systems where precise location and movement tracking are paramount. They enable accurate navigation in environments where GPS signals are unavailable or unreliable, such as underground tunnels or underwater.

  1. Aerospace and aviation systems utilize inertial navigation algorithms to provide continuous positional data during flight, especially when GPS signals are obstructed. This enhances safety, stability, and autonomous flight capabilities.
  2. Military applications, including missile guidance and submarine navigation, rely heavily on inertial navigation algorithms for covert, precise movement tracking without external signals.
  3. Autonomous vehicles and drones employ these algorithms for real-time positioning and path planning, crucial for operational safety and efficiency in complex terrains or urban environments.

These applications demonstrate the versatility of inertial navigation algorithms in ensuring reliable and accurate positioning across diverse systems, even under challenging conditions. Their integration with sensor fusion technologies further broadens their scope, supporting mission-critical operations worldwide.

Future Trends and Innovations in Inertial Navigation Algorithms

Advancements in sensor technology are anticipated to significantly enhance inertial navigation algorithms, increasing their precision and reliability in challenging environments. Innovations such as micro-electromechanical systems (MEMS) are enabling miniaturization and cost reduction.

Machine learning and artificial intelligence are set to play a vital role in future developments. These technologies can improve error correction, sensor fusion, and system adaptability, leading to more robust navigation solutions in dynamic conditions.

Additionally, integration with other navigation systems, such as Global Navigation Satellite Systems (GNSS) and visual odometry, is expected to evolve. These hybrid approaches will likely address current limitations, particularly in environments with limited satellite signals or poor visibility.

Overall, future trends in inertial navigation algorithms focus on increased accuracy, resilience, and cost-effectiveness. Continued research and technological innovation promise to make inertial navigation systems more versatile across diverse applications.

Critical Evaluation of Inertial Navigation Algorithms

Inertial navigation algorithms are vital for accurate position determination, yet they possess inherent limitations that merit careful evaluation. Their primary challenge lies in error accumulation over time, which can significantly affect long-term accuracy without external correction.

Scroll to Top